Cucumber Salad with Dill Sour Cream

Cool, refreshing, and bursting with vibrant flavors, this Cucumber Salad with Dill Sour Cream is a quick and easy side dish that will elevate any meal. Featuring crisp cucumber slices and delicate red onion tossed in a creamy dressing made with tangy sour cream, fresh dill, zesty lemon juice, and a touch of garlic, this salad strikes the perfect balance between light and indulgent. A sprinkling of sugar enhances the natural sweetness of the cucumbers, while a pinch of salt and black pepper ties it all together. Ready in just 15 minutes, it's an effortless dish that's perfect for picnics, summer barbecues, or even as a refreshing snack. Serve it chilled to enjoy the full medley of flavors in every bite!

Prep Time:15 mins
Cook Time:0 mins
Total Time:15 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 2 large cucumbers
  • 0.5 cup sour cream
  • 2 tablespoons fresh dill
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 small (minced) garlic clove
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on black pepper
  • 0.5 teaspoon sugar
  • 0.25 cup (thinly sliced) red onion

Directions

Step 1

Start by washing the cucumbers thoroughly and patting them dry. Slice them thinly using either a sharp knife or a mandoline for even slices.

Step 2

Place the cucumber slices in a colander and sprinkle a small pinch of salt over them. Let them sit for about 10 minutes to draw out excess water. Pat them dry with a paper towel afterward.

Step 3

In a mixing bowl, combine the sour cream, fresh dill, lemon juice, minced garlic, salt, pepper, and sugar. Stir until the dressing is smooth and well combined.

Step 4

Add the cucumber slices and thinly sliced red onion to the bowl with the dressing. Toss gently to coat the cucumbers and onions evenly in the creamy mixture.

Step 5

Taste and adjust the seasoning as needed, adding a pinch more salt, pepper, or lemon juice based on your preference.

Step 6

Refrigerate the salad for at least 10 minutes before serving to let the flavors meld together. Serve chilled as a side dish or snack.
